在Ubuntu系统中,/var/spool
目录通常用于存储临时文件和邮件等。为了确保系统的安全性和稳定性,正确设置 /var/spool
目录的权限非常重要。以下是一些常见的权限设置方法和步骤:
首先,你可以使用 ls -l
命令查看 /var/spool
目录的当前权限:
ls -l /var/spool
通常情况下,/var/spool
目录及其子目录的权限应该设置为 755
,这意味着目录的所有者有读、写和执行权限,而其他用户只有读和执行权限。
sudo chmod -R 755 /var/spool
确保 /var/spool
目录及其子目录的所有者是 root
用户和 root
组:
sudo chown -R root:root /var/spool
某些子目录可能需要不同的权限设置。例如,/var/spool/mail
目录通常用于存储用户的邮件文件,这些文件的权限可能需要更严格。
/var/spool/mail
权限sudo chmod 700 /var/spool/mail
sudo chown root:mail /var/spool/mail
如果你需要更细粒度的权限控制,可以使用 ACL。例如,你可以为特定用户或组设置额外的权限。
sudo apt-get install acl
sudo setfacl -R -m u:username:rwx /var/spool
sudo setfacl -R -m g:groupname:rwx /var/spool
最后,再次使用 ls -l
命令验证权限设置是否正确:
ls -l /var/spool
通过以上步骤,你可以有效地调整Ubuntu系统中 /var/spool
目录的权限,确保系统的安全性和稳定性。